As we look toward The Florida Orchestra’s next fifty years, we are filled with enormous pride in the collaboration between the orchestra and the Tampa Bay community. Each season, we strive to share our music with you and everyone who loves music across Tampa Bay and beyond. Sharing music, after all, is at the core of everything we do. Under the leadership of Maestro Michael Francis, we have an incredible season of concerts to look forward to at the Mahaffey Theater, Ruth Eckerd Hall, and the Straz Center for the Performing Arts, from Beethoven’s 7th Symphony to the music of Star Trek & Star Wars. We continue our commitment to the community through outreach programs including our Pops in the Park concerts, TFO on the Go, “Sing Out! Tampa Bay”, and our chamber music series at the Dr. Carter G. Woodson African American Museum. New in our 50th anniversary season, we have added two matinee series at the Mahaffey Theater, expanded our Coffee series at Ruth Eckerd Hall, and have just presented the first of the Harry Potter films with orchestra at the Straz Center. Last but certainly not least, we are thrilled to announce our 50th Anniversary Gala, An Intimate Evening with The Florida Orchestra and Sting, on December 9th. A limited number of Gala tables at a dinner with Sting remain available. Our 50th season serves as an historic milestone, not only to celebrate our rich history, but to look forward to the myriad of ways this institution will be able to serve over the next fifty years.
